Файл: _modules/admin/stats/index.php
Строк: 237
<?php
# mark core v1.0
# author Drk in
# date 24.10.19
# core
require_once ( $_SERVER['DOCUMENT_ROOT']."/_core/system.php" );
# meta
$title = 'Статистика » Мобильные WAP сайты';
$description = system::check($config['description']);
$keywords = system::check($config['keywords']);
$tl = 'Статистика';
# adm
system::adm();
# head
require_once ( head );
# coutn
$cn_user = DB :: $dbh -> querySingle("SELECT count(id) FROM user");
$cn_user_d = DB :: $dbh -> querySingle("SELECT count(id) FROM user WHERE data_reg > ?;", array(time()-86400));
$cn_user_b = DB :: $dbh -> querySingle("SELECT count(id) FROM user WHERE ban = ?;", array(1));
$cn_cat = DB :: $dbh -> querySingle("SELECT count(id) FROM cat");
$cn_pf =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ms");
$cn_pf_d =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E time > ?;", array(time()-86400));
$cn_pf_m =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E mode = ?;", array(1));
$cn_pf_m_d =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E mode = ? AND time > ?;", array(1,time()-86400));
$cn_pf_b =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E ban = ?;", array(1));
$cn_pf_b_d =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E ban = ? AND time > ?;", array(1,time()-86400));
$cn_pf_g = DB :: $dbh -> querySingle("SELECT count(id) FROM platforms WHERE gold > ? ", array(time()));
$cn_hs = DB :: $dbh -> querySingle("SELECT sum(hs) FROM platforms");
$cn_ht = DB :: $dbh -> querySingle("SELECT sum(ht) FROM platforms");
$cn_in = DB :: $dbh -> querySingle("SELECT sum(`in`) FROM platforms");
$cn_ou = DB :: $dbh -> querySingle("SELECT sum(`ou`) FROM platforms");
$cn_pc = DB :: $dbh -> querySingle("SELECT sum(pc) FROM platforms");
$cn_mb = DB :: $dbh -> querySingle("SELECT sum(mb) FROM platforms");
$cn_hs_t = DB :: $dbh -> querySingle("SELECT sum(hs_to) FROM platforms");
$cn_ht_t = DB :: $dbh -> querySingle("SELECT sum(ht_to) FROM platforms");
$cn_in_t = DB :: $dbh -> querySingle("SELECT sum(in_to) FROM platforms");
$cn_ou_t = DB :: $dbh -> querySingle("SELECT sum(ou_to) FROM platforms");
$cn_pc_t = DB :: $dbh -> querySingle("SELECT sum(pc_to) FROM platforms");
$cn_mb_t = DB :: $dbh -> querySingle("SELECT sum(mb_to) FROM platforms");
$cn_hs_a = DB :: $dbh -> querySingle("SELECT sum(hs_all) FROM platforms");
$cn_ht_a = DB :: $dbh -> querySingle("SELECT sum(ht_all) FROM platforms");
$cn_in_a = DB :: $dbh -> querySingle("SELECT sum(in_all) FROM platforms");
$cn_ou_a = DB :: $dbh -> querySingle("SELECT sum(ou_all) FROM platforms");
$cn_pc_a = DB :: $dbh -> querySingle("SELECT sum(pc_all) FROM platforms");
$cn_mb_a = DB :: $dbh -> querySingle("SELECT sum(mb_all) FROM platforms");
$cn_tk = DB :: $dbh -> querySingle("SELECT count(id) FROM tk");
$cn_tkcat = DB :: $dbh -> querySingle("SELECT count(id) FROM tkcat");
$cn_tkcom = DB :: $dbh -> querySingle("SELECT count(id) FROM tkcom");
$cn_tk_d = DB :: $dbh -> querySingle("SELECT count(id) FROM tk WHERE time > ?;", array(time()-86400));
$cn_tkcom_d = DB :: $dbh -> querySingle("SELECT count(id) FROM tkcom WHERE time > ?;", array(time()-86400));
echo '
<div class ="touch">
Зарегистрировано пользователей : <font color ="green">'.$cn_user.'</font> '.($cn_user_d != 0 ? '<font color ="red">+ '.$cn_user_d.'</font> сегодня':'').'
<br> Заблокированых пользователей : <font color ="green">'.$cn_user_b.'</font>
<hr>
Зарегистрировано сайтов: <font color ="green">'.$cn_pf.'</font> '.($cn_pf_d != 0 ? '<font color ="red">+ '.$cn_pf_d.'</font> сегодня':'').'
<br> На модерации сайтов: <font color ="green">'.$cn_pf_m.'</font> '.($cn_pf_m_d != 0 ? '<font color ="red">+ '.$cn_pf_m_d.'</font> сегодня':'').'
<br> Заблокированых сайтов: <font color ="green">'.$cn_pf_b.'</font> '.($cn_pf_b_d != 0 ? '<font color ="red">+ '.$cn_pf_b_d.'</font> сегодня':'').'
<br> GOLD сайтов: <font color ="green">'.$cn_pf_g.'</font>
<hr> Тикетов : <font color ="green">'.$cn_tk.'</font> '.($cn_tk_d != 0 ? '<font color ="red">+ '.$cn_tk_d.'</font> сегодня':'').'
<br> Комментарии тикетов : <font color ="green">'.$cn_tkcom.'</font> '.($cn_tkcom_d != 0 ? '<font color ="red">+ '.$cn_tkcom_d.'</font> сегодня':'').'
<br> Категории тикетов : <font color ="green">'.$cn_tkcat.'</font>
<hr> Категорий : <font color ="green">'.$cn_cat.'</font>
</div>
<div class="touch">
<table border="1" width="100%" style="text-align:center;">
<tbody><tr>
<td>период</td><td>хостов</td><td>хитов</td><td>в топ/из топа</td>
</tr>
<tr>
<td><b>Cегодня</b></td>
<td><font color="green">'.$cn_hs.'</font></td>
<td><font color="red">'.$cn_ht.'</font></td>
<td>'.$cn_in.'/'.$cn_ou.'</td>
</tr>
</tbody></table>
<div style="padding: 4px;">
<img src="'.ico.'mob.png" title="Мобильные и планшеты"> '.$cn_mb.' <b>
<font color="red">+</font></b>
<img src="'.ico.'pc.png" title="ПК"> '.$cn_pc.' <b>
<font color="red">=</font></b> <u>'.($cn_mb + $cn_pc).'</u> хостов.
</div>
</div>
<div class="touch">
<table border="1" width="100%" style="text-align:center;">
<tbody><tr>
<td>период</td><td>хостов</td><td>хитов</td><td>в топ/из топа</td>
</tr>
<tr>
<td><b>За вчера</b></td>
<td><font color="green">'.$cn_hs_t.'</font></td>
<td><font color="red">'.$cn_ht_t.'</font></td>
<td>'.$cn_in_t.'/'.$cn_ou_t.'</td>
</tr>
</tbody></table>
<div style="padding: 4px;">
<img src="'.ico.'mob.png" title="Мобильные и планшеты"> '.$cn_mb_t.' <b>
<font color="red">+</font></b>
<img src="'.ico.'pc.png" title="ПК"> '.$cn_pc_t.' <b>
<font color="red">=</font></b> <u>'.($cn_mb_t + $cn_pc_t).'</u> хостов.
</div>
</div>
<div class="touch">
<table border="1" width="100%" style="text-align:center;">
<tbody><tr>
<td>период</td><td>хостов</td><td>хитов</td><td>в топ/из топа</td>
</tr>
<tr>
<td><b>За месяц</b></td>
<td><font color="green">'.$cn_hs_a.'</font></td>
<td><font color="red">'.$cn_ht_a.'</font></td>
<td>'.$cn_in_a.'/'.$cn_ou_a.'</td>
</tr>
</tbody></table>
<div style="padding: 4px;">
<img src="'.ico.'mob.png" title="Мобильные и планшеты"> '.$cn_mb_a.' <b>
<font color="red">+</font></b>
<img src="'.ico.'pc.png" title="ПК"> '.$cn_pc_a.' <b>
<font color="red">=</font></b> <u>'.($cn_mb_a + $cn_pc_a).'</u> хостов.
</div>
</div>
<a href="'.site.'admin" class="touch">« Назад</a>
';
# foot
require_once ( foot ) ;
?>